Step into a

dynamic, high‑acuity environment

at Swedish Medical Center–First Hill, where you’ll manage a diverse caseload in a state‑of‑the‑art facility with:

Over 7,500 annual deliveries

Full‑scope MFM procedures and reproductive health services

Consultative outreach in Everett and Issaquah

A regional referral base spanning the Pacific Northwest and southern Alaska

Paid Sick Leave:

Eligible full‑time team members will receive a lump‑sum grant of 70 hours or eight days, whichever is more beneficial to the team member, of paid sick leave each year on January 1. A newly hired full‑time team member will receive a prorated lump‑sum grant after working for 90 days. A lumpsum grant will then be provided on January 1 in each subsequent year as long as the team member remains eligible. Unused sick leave granted under this policy does not carry over from one year to the following year. The Company will not pay team members for unused sick leave upon termination of employment.

About Us Pediatrix Medical Group is one of the nation’s leading providers of highly specialized health care for women, babies and children. Since 1979, Pediatrix has grown from a single neonatology practice to a national, multispecialty medical group.
